The lattice energy ( Hlattice) of an ionic compound is defined as the energy required to separate one mole of the solid into its component gaseous ions. Pacific Coast First Nations Clothing, Magnesium comes from Group 2; as a metal it needs to lose 2 electrons to assume a Noble Gas configuration (that of neon); on the other hand iodine needs to gain 1 electron to assume the xenon configuration. Ionic bonding is a type of chemical bond that involves the electrostatic attraction between oppositely charged ions, and is the primary interaction occurring in ionic compounds.
